Ingredients

  1. 1 cup fresh parsley
  2. ½ cup extra-virgin olive oil
  3. 2 tablespoons fresh oregano
  4. 2 tablespoons red wine vinegar
  5. 1 tablespoon water
  6. 1 jalapeno chile pepper, seeded
  7. 2 cloves garlic, chopped
  8. ½ teaspoon salt
  9. ½ teaspoon ground black pepper

Instructions

  1. Gather all ingredients.

  3. Combine parsley, olive oil, oregano, red wine vinegar, water, jalapeno, garlic, salt, and pepper in the bowl of a food processor.

  5. Pulse ingredients until desired consistency is reached.
